About The Position

As the Principal Product Manager for Asset Subscriptions, you will own the performance and growth of the subscription business end-to-end, including the product experience and value proposition. You will be responsible for how the subscription is perceived, understood, and performs, working across product, design, engineering, marketing, and data to create a cohesive experience from initial contact through long-term usage. This role is central to unifying KitBash3D, Greyscalegorilla, and other asset offerings into a single ecosystem. You will ensure the subscription is clear, cohesive, and valuable across diverse customer bases, while driving measurable improvements in growth and retention. The ideal candidate is customer-focused, opinionated, outcome-driven, with strong product instincts, a sharp sense of value and positioning, and a bias toward action, comfortable operating in ambiguity, moving quickly, and utilizing modern tools to accelerate work without sacrificing quality. This position can be remote or hybrid and is open to US candidates based in CA, FL, IL, IN, MI, NC, OR, SC, TN, TX, UT, or WA, with local candidates having the option to work from offices in Portland, Oregon or Libertyville, Illinois.

Responsibilities

  • Own the performance and growth of the asset subscription business, increasing ARR by improving conversion, activation, retention, and expansion through both product experience and how that value is communicated to customers.
  • Develop a deep understanding of our customers, segments, and use cases through qualitative and quantitative inputs. Identify where value resonates, where it breaks, and where the biggest opportunities exist, and use those insights to set priorities and guide decisions.
  • Own the asset subscription experience end-to-end, partnering with design and engineering to define, build, and ship improvements that drive user behavior, while ensuring the offering feels cohesive, premium, and worth paying for across the product ecosystem.
  • Define and own how the subscription is understood by customers, shaping its positioning, value proposition, and communication across product, web, and lifecycle touch-points. Partner with marketing and content to deliver a clear, consistent story, and drive experiments that improve how customers perceive and respond to that value.
  • Lead initiatives from idea to launch by working directly with design, engineering, marketing, finance, and operations. Partner with department leaders to ensure campaigns, payments, and policies are handled correctly, while aligning with other product leaders to keep our product decisions and product ecosystem cohesive.
